Full Job Description
We are looking for a specialized Cloud Security Engineer to secure our next-generation multi-region architecture. In this role, you will architect, implement, and automate robust security controls across AWS - spanning enterprise IAM, Public Key Infrastructure (PKI), secrets management, and cloud security posture management (CSPM) - while ensuring strict compliance for PCI-scoped fintech workloads. Req.#[redacted] Responsibilities Identity & Access Management: Design and enforce secure AWS IAM policies, roles, permission boundaries, Service Control Policies (SCPs), and EKS Pod Identity / IRSA configurations Cloud Detection & Posture Management: Implement and manage security monitoring and posture tools including Amazon GuardDuty, AWS Security Hub, AWS CloudTrail, Macie, and IAM Access Analyzer PKI & Certificate Management: Build and manage automated certificate lifecycle workflows using AWS Private CA (FIPS 140-2 Level 3 HSM-backed), ACM, and mTLS trust stores, coordinating closely with the client's Security approvals Secrets & Encryption: Secure sensitive data using AWS KMS (including Multi-Region Keys), Secrets Manager, and the External Secrets Operator Requirements Baseline (Mandatory): Strong hands-on experience with AWS CDK and TypeScript for security-as-code automation AWS PKI & TLS: Deep expertise in AWS Private CA (HSM-backed), ACM, mTLS trust stores, automated certificate issuance/rotation/revocation, and PayPal Security compliance workflows Proficiency with Amazon GuardDuty, Security Hub (AWS FSBP, CIS, NIST benchmarks), Macie, and IAM Access Analyzer Experience supporting strict PCI-scoped fintech audits and CSPM frameworks Identity & Secrets Management: Advanced IAM expertise (roles, trust policies, permission boundaries, SCPs, IRSA/EKS Pod Identity), Secrets Manager, External Secrets Operator, and KMS/MRK envelope encryption Supply Chain & Application Security: SAST tools (SonarQube, CodeQL), Dependabot, and software supply chain security (image signing and provenance via Cosign/SLSA) integrated with CDK & TypeScript Nice to have Experience with Wiz (CSPM/CNAPP) Advanced deployments of AWS Private CA (PCA) and complex KMS key hierarchies
